From the Rolls-Royce experimental archive: a quarter of a million communications from Rolls-Royce, 1906 to 1960's. Documents from the Sir Henry Royce Memorial Foundation (SHRMF).
Letter to C.R. Fairey regarding car modifications for the starting handle and number plate.

X4117 Expl. Dept. Hs.{Lord Ernest Hives - Chair}/MJ. February 26th.1932. C.R. Fairey Esq., The Fairey Aviation Co. Ltd., Hayes, Middlesex. Bear Mr. Fairey, In our endeavour to let you have the car yesterday, we overlooked the fact that some modifications will be necessary in order to be able to insert the starting handle. We are looking into the best way of doing this and will let you know what we decide. The other point is that the number plate was not fixed on very satisfactorily. I met the car on my way back and it was obvious that the number plate was going to obstruct the pot light. You may have some preference to where you would like the front number plate fixed. If there is anything you wish us to do perhaps you will arrange to send the car in to Cricklewood. Yours faithfully, For Rolls-Royce Ltd. | ||
